Vice President María Antonieta Mejía has called on lawmakers to hold a technical debate on proposed reforms to the state-run electricity company ENEE, which faces losses of about 16 billion lempiras (roughly $640 million) and is hampering public investment in education and infrastructure.

Congress is prepared to review the executive's proposal to restructure the state electricity utility ENEE to reduce its 38% loss rate—which costs the state approximately L1.3 billion monthly—and lower electricity costs for consumers.

The government will submit a comprehensive electricity-sector reform bill to Congress this week that would split ENEE into three functional divisions—generation, transmission, and distribution—aiming to cut system losses of nearly 38% and stabilize tariffs, officials say.
